What Exactly Is a No KYC Casino?
A no KYC casino is exactly what it sounds like: a gambling platform that doesn’t demand Know Your Customer documents before you deposit, play, or withdraw. Traditional sites ask for scans of your passport, proof of address, and sometimes even income statements. That process can take hours or days. No KYC sites let you register with just an email and a password, then you’re in. They rely on offshore licences, SSL encryption, and crypto wallets to keep things secure without the paperwork. Some call them “anonymous casinos” or “no ID casinos,” but the core promise is the same-play now, verify later (if ever).

The Trade-Offs You Need to Know
Let’s not pretend there are no downsides. Some no KYC casinos operate under lighter regulatory oversight than UKGC-licensed sites. That means responsible gambling tools-like deposit limits, session reminders, and self-exclusion-can be weaker or missing entirely. Also, if you win big, some platforms may still ask for ID before paying out. The trick is to choose operators with a valid offshore licence (e.g., Curacao) and a proven track record. Avoid any site that feels shady or lacks live chat. A no ID casino should still feel professional, not fly-by-night.
